The Academic Program 3. Language Requirement The department requires students to acquire a working knowledge of one language in addition to English during the master's program. The language should help the student work with primary sources or with scholarship in a field of special interest. For example, students electing the religions of South Asia as an emphasis area may take Sanskrit. Those electing New Testament studies may take Greek. If an exception to the language requirement is appropriate due to the background of a student, the student may request that the requirement be waived. The request must be submitted to the Director of Graduate Studies by the end of the second semester of graduate study. The Director of Graduate Studies will present the request to the department faculty for a decision. |
